GNSS Satellite Autonomous Integrity Monitoring (SAIM) using inter-satellite measurements
Integrity is the ability of Global Navigation Satellite Systems (GNSS) to detect faults in measurements and provide timely warnings to users and operators when the navigation system cannot meet the defined performance standards, which is of great importance for safety of life critical applications. Flood Hazard Assessment Using Panchromatic Satellite Imagery
Panchromatic (PAN) satellite imagery has been used successfully in different applications such as topographic mapping and terrain modelling. Nevertheless, PAN imagery is still one of the less used digital sources for land-change studies except few processes where the high-resolution of the PAN images is used to improve the visualization quality of the multi-spectral images. متن کاملMobile internet access using satellite networks
Satellites offer a promising alternative for mobile access to the Internet by both pedestrians, and more importantly, from vehicles. As such, satellites provide an essential complement to the cellular radio (UMTS) infrastructure in sparsely populated areas where high bandwidth UMTS cells cannot be economically deployed.
